Anope IRC Services

Anope is a set of IRC Services designed for flexibility and ease of use.

Anope is available in two flavors: Stable and Development. The stable version has been tested for months and is as stable as a rock, while the development version gets new features added constantly and allows you to enjoy the future of services today.



Latest News - Anope 1.8.3 Release

6 months since the last stable branch update, we are pleased to announce the immediate availability of Anope 1.8.3.

This release brings to the table several bug fixes and official support for InspIRCd 1.2.

We have also taken the decision to move to Visual Studio 2008 for our precompiled Windows versions. This means that if you do not already have 2008 Runtimes you will need those but as several module authors have already moved to this version you may already have them.

You can download them from here.

As with all of our releases we would recommend you take a known good back up and perform testing in a testnet environment with your current databases and modules before considering upgrading your live network. We would however recommend anyone using any versions of 1.6, 1.7 or 1.8 to update as soon as possible.
